Rugby Union - 1974 Five Nations Championship - Wales 6 Scotland 0
The Wales Team Group before the game at Cardiff Arms Park on 19/01/1974.
Back Row (left to right): J. C. Kelleher (linesman), Glyn Shaw, Mervyn Davies, Allan Martin, Derek Quinnell, Phil Llewellyn, Keith Hughes, Dai Morris, R. F. Johnson (referee).
Front: JPR Williams, Gerald Davies, Clive Rowlands (coach), Gareth Edwards (captain), Bobby Windsor, Phil Bennett, Terry Cobner.
Ground: JJ Williams, Ian Hall
